When Should You Visit Urgent Care in Odessa TX?
Knowing when to choose urgent care can help you receive appropriate treatment without unnecessarily visiting an emergency department. Urgent care is generally appropriate for non-life-threatening conditions that still require timely medical attention.
Common reasons to visit an urgent care clinic Odessa include:
- Cold, flu, and respiratory symptoms
- Sore throat and strep throat
- Earaches and minor ear infections
- Sinus pressure and sinus infections
- Fever
- Cough and congestion
- Minor cuts and burns
- Sprains and strains
- Sports-related injuries
- Minor fractures
- Skin rashes and infections
- Insect bites
- Urinary tract infections
- Mild stomach problems
- Vomiting and diarrhea
- Allergic reactions that are not severe
- Minor workplace injuries

Urgent Care vs. Emergency Room
One of the most important decisions is determining whether you need urgent care or emergency medical treatment.
Urgent care is generally intended for non-life-threatening medical concerns. Emergency rooms are equipped to handle severe or potentially life-threatening conditions. Medical Center Health System lists symptoms such as uncontrolled bleeding, severe breathing problems, seizures, significant head injuries, serious burns, spinal injuries, and sudden changes in mental status among situations requiring emergency care.
Seek emergency medical attention immediately for symptoms such as severe chest pain, difficulty breathing, loss of consciousness, severe bleeding, signs of stroke, or other life-threatening conditions. In an emergency, call 911.
What to Bring to an Urgent Care Clinic
Preparing a few basic items before your visit can make the check-in process easier. Consider bringing:
- Photo identification
- Insurance card
- List of current medications
- Information about allergies
- Relevant medical records, if available
- Details about when your symptoms started
- Information about previous treatments or medications taken for the current problem
Some clinics may offer online check-in, which can help reduce time spent waiting in the lobby.
